On Fri, Mar 16, 2018 at 06:00:19PM +0100, Vitaly Kuznetsov wrote:
> KVM recently gained support for Hyper-V Reenlightenment MSRs which are
> required to make KVM-on-Hyper-V enable TSC page clocksource to its guests
> when INVTSC is not passed to it (and it is not passed by default in Qemu
> as it effectively blocks migration).

Can you please add a matching comment to the definition of
feature_word_info[FEAT_HYPERV_EAX].feat_names[]?

Also there appears to be no cpu property to turn this on/off, does it?
It's enabled based only on the support in the KVM it's running against.
So I guess we may have a problem migrating between the hosts with
different KVM versions, one supporting it and the other not.
(This is also a problem with has_msr_hv_frequencies, and is in general a
long-standing issue of hv_* properties being done differently from the
rest of CPUID features.)
